Output c314088d0723e6b036e3f8926237a853c2cbb6e54a35db32a81d3d97edf8821c:12

value
220091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ffbb44a3877d0c8742f49dd789f700376a6f48d OP_EQUAL
address
34c8QD51tqpSLABk6funCzF85dXuw2FAFK
transaction
c314088d0723e6b036e3f8926237a853c2cbb6e54a35db32a81d3d97edf8821c
confirmations
201352
spent
true